Ticket: Staging env misconfigured for Siftgate bloom filter

The bloom layer in front of the Pellet KV store is rejecting all lookups in staging because the env file was copied from the dev template without credentials. False-positive tuning values are fine; only the auth line is missing. To unblock the weekly demo, the Pellet admission secret must be set on the following line.

env line for yaguf-fajop: LEDGER_TOKEN13=fb08984397349

**14:22 UTC** — Exports from the Glimmerbox pipeline started failing again, so we flipped on the new retry queue. Heads up for plugin authors: failed exports now retry up to three times with backoff before landing in the dead-letter view, so don't re-submit manually — you'll just create duplicates. Marnie from the Pipeline team confirmed all stuck jobs from last night have drained. The retry batch we replayed carries the trace below.

pipeline stamp: htk9_ce63042d9

**Release checklist — CastCheck feed validator v2.4**

Before tagging: run the full conformance suite against the sample feed corpus. Confirm the validator flags missing episode GUIDs, malformed durations, and oversized artwork. Verify the new namespace warnings don't fire on valid feeds from the Thornbury test set. Check that the CLI exit codes match the docs. Update the changelog. Do not tag until all eight smoke feeds pass clean. Record results in the release sheet alongside the candidate's build token, printed below.

build token for kagaf-hahof: htk14_9d3d4d26d7d8de